In Fire Emblem: Seisen no Keifu players takes the roles of Sigurd and his son Seliph across a variety of story-driven missions on the continent of Jugdral. The story is divided into chapters, which are in turn divided between two generations of characters. In between missions, the player units settle in a home base, where various actions such as forging new weapons, buying items, and triggering Support conversations between different characters. Castle towns within mission maps can also be visited for similar services.

Super NES Global Problems

[edit]

Problems that may occur with any Super NES title on Dolphin are listed below.

Glitched Sound

Sound is glitched in the OpenAL backend. Use XAudio2 to prevent this. Fixed in 5.0-798.

Problems

Stretched Output / Black Screen

Most graphics are stretched 100% horizontally to the right side of the screen, so only half the image is displayed. In newer revisions the stretching has been replaced by black output. Disable EFB Copies to Texture Only to fix this. Refer issue 10711. Set in game ini since 5.0-9262.
